Key blanks (specifically the slot in them) changed each year. If you look at original GM keys, there is a small letter on it which tells you which style it is.

I had a chat with an old-timer locksmith a few months back when I was fixing the locks on the coupe. He said (if I recall correctly) that they repeated every 4 years. My coupe had 1 door key (which actually would only operate 1 door lock), and 3 decklid keys (decklid swap)...I pulled all the locks out of a donor car sedan thinking I'd change them, but the coupe and sedan door lock cylinders have different shafts where the lever goes on. Long story short, he custom -milled some keys to work with my combination of 81 and 82 cylinders.

The 4 year thing worked until the official G-body era. Then they CHANGED them every 4 years starting in 1983. Friggin stupid.

Here's the letter coding for the years, ignition key first letter/door and console and-or glovebox key second letter...

1968 - (C, D)
1969 - (E, H)
1970 - (J, K)
1971 - (A, B)
1972 - (C, D)
1973 - (E, H)
1974 - (J, K)
1975 - (A, B)
1976 - (C, D)
1977 - (E, H)
1978 - (J, K)
1979 - (A, B)
1980 - (C, D)
1981 - (E, H)
1982 - (J, K)
1983 to 1986 - (A, B)
1987 to 1990 - (C, D)
1991 to 1994 - (E, H)
